Loni Anderson Has Died Aged 79

 


American actress Loni Anderson has died just days before her 80th birthday.

The star is the former wife of Burt Reynolds, and she played a receptionist in the hit TV comedy WKRP In Cincinnati.

Anderson’s family released a statement just yesterday, confirming that the actress passed away in the hospital.

They said: “We are heartbroken to announce the passing of our dear wife, mother, and grandmother.”

Anderson starred on the big screen alongside her former husband Reynolds in the 1983 comedy, Stroker Ace.

The pair later got married in 1983, and became a power couple in the media.

They adopted a son, Quinton Reynolds, before divorcing in 1994.

During the unveiling of a bronze bust at Reynolds’ Hollywood grave site in 2021, the star noted that Quinton was ‘the best decision that we ever made in our entire relationship.’

Anderson also had a daughter named Deidra Hoffman, with her first husband Bruce Hasselberg.

‘My Life In High Heels’ was the title of the actress’s 1995 autobiography, in which she detailed her tumultuous marriage to Reynolds.

Speaking about the book, Anderson said: “It’s about my childhood, the death of my parents, my career, my divorces, and my children.

“Then of course, the trauma of my marriage to Burt.

“I think if you’re going to write about yourself, you have to do it warts and all.”

She added: “You may not even tell the nicest things about yourself, because you’re telling the truth.”

But it seems the star had numerous attempts at relationships, as she was married four times throughout her life – most recently to Bob Flick in 2008.

Anderson’s role as s**y and smart receptionist Jennifer Marlowe in WKRP In Cincinnati earned her two Emmy Awards and three Golden Globe nominations.

The comedy series was set in a struggling Ohio radio station, that was trying to reinvent itself with rock music.

The character of Jennifer used her s** appeal to deflect unwanted business calls for her boss, Mr. Carlson.

Anderson also starred in the short-lived comedy series Easy Street, and appeared in made-for-TV films including A Letter To Three Wives, and White Hot: The Mysterious Murder of Thelma Todd.

The actress was born on August 5, 1945, in Saint Paul, Minnesota, and her first role was a small part in the 1966 film Nevada Smith.

Anderson’s death comes as a result of an ‘acute prolonged illness.’

Her family added: “Notably, she had been vocal in raising awareness about ch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D).

“Her parents were heavy smokers, and she became their primary caregiver before their death.”

COPD is a progressive lung condition that obstructs breathing.

It is a more general term for certain types of lung or airway damage, and smoking is the most common cause.
